As an alum of U of Iowa (BFA, Design) who lives in DC (working in the museum
field), I am happy to let you know about special exhibits here. Tomorrow,
the Phillips opens an exceptional show of Georgia O'Keefe. The National
Gallery has an exhibit from the Horowitz Collectioin (American
Impressionists), and an exhibit of John Singer Sargent. The Hirshhorn has a
good show of contemporary artists (permanent collection). If your interest
is primarily art, don't miss the National Museum of American Art/Portrait
Gallery. If you are interested in seeing as many museums as possible, all of
the Smithsonian museums are worth visiting.
